The Graham Georgetown — Georgetown
$$$ Upscale
★ 9.0 Superb

Georgetown's premier boutique hotel occupies a handsome Federal building steps from Wisconsin Avenue, with 57 rooms that balance historic character with upscale comfort, and a rooftop lounge with views over Georgetown's slate rooftops to the Washington Monument. The intimate scale makes it feel like a private club rather than a hotel.

Riggs Washington DC — Penn Quarter
$$$ Upscale
★ 9.1 Superb

A stunning adaptive reuse of the 1891 Riggs National Bank building — a Washington institution that handled the payroll for the Civil War — with the original banking hall now housing Silver Lyan, a spectacular cocktail bar with a cerulean mosaic ceiling. The 181 rooms combine the grandeur of the gilded banking era with contemporary Italian design.

The Willard InterContinental Washington DC — Downtown / Penn Quarter
$$$$ Ultra-luxury
★ 9.1 Superb

Two blocks from the White House and serving the republic since 1818, The Willard is where Abraham Lincoln stayed before his inauguration and where the word 'lobbyist' is said to have originated in its lobby. The Beaux-Arts grandeur of the Round Robin Bar and the soaring atrium have made it the unofficial parlor room of American democracy.
